Korea Line (005880) — Tangible Net Worth Ratio

Latest as of March 2026: 99.8%

Korea Line (005880) has a Tangible Net Worth Ratio of 99.8% as of March 2026. This metric is calculated by deducting intangible assets (₩4.42 Billion) from net assets (₩2.60 Trillion) and expressing it as a percentage of total net assets. A higher ratio means that more of the company's equity is backed by tangible, balance-sheet-verifiable assets rather than goodwill, patents, or brand value. Annual Tangible Net Worth Ratio for Korea Line (2000–2025)

The table below presents the year-by-year Tangible Net Worth Ratio for Korea Line from 2000 to 2025, covering 25 annual filings. Each row shows net assets, intangible assets, total assets, the tangible net worth ratio, and the change in percentage points versus the prior year. Year Tangible NW Ratio Net Assets (KRW) Intangible Assets Total Assets Change (pp)
2025 99.8% ₩2.41 Trillion ₩4.46 Billion ₩4.11 Trillion ▲ +0.0 pp
2024 99.8% ₩2.29 Trillion ₩4.66 Billion ₩4.58 Trillion ▲ +0.0 pp
2023 99.8% ₩1.85 Trillion ₩4.56 Billion ₩4.73 Trillion ▲ +0.0 pp
2022 99.7% ₩1.78 Trillion ₩4.91 Billion ₩4.49 Trillion ▲ +0.1 pp
2021 99.7% ₩1.52 Trillion ₩5.27 Billion ₩3.86 Trillion ▲ +0.3 pp
2020 99.4% ₩853.32 Billion ₩5.18 Billion ₩3.35 Trillion ▲ +0.1 pp
2019 99.3% ₩895.20 Billion ₩6.07 Billion ₩3.34 Trillion ▲ +0.4 pp
2018 98.9% ₩779.48 Billion ₩8.62 Billion ₩2.93 Trillion ▲ +0.2 pp
2017 98.6% ₩687.84 Billion ₩9.31 Billion ₩2.59 Trillion ▲ +0.1 pp
2016 98.6% ₩626.01 Billion ₩8.87 Billion ₩2.20 Trillion ▼ -0.8 pp
2015 99.4% ₩569.36 Billion ₩3.31 Billion ₩1.52 Trillion ▲ +0.3 pp
2014 99.1% ₩498.88 Billion ₩4.58 Billion ₩1.30 Trillion ▲ +0.4 pp
2013 98.7% ₩404.03 Billion ₩5.27 Billion ₩1.22 Trillion ▲ +1.5 pp
2011 97.2% ₩100.70 Billion ₩2.77 Billion ₩1.73 Trillion ▼ -1.8 pp
2010 99.0% ₩543.89 Billion ₩5.44 Billion ₩2.77 Trillion ▼ -0.8 pp
2009 99.8% ₩640.75 Billion ₩1.23 Billion ₩2.75 Trillion ▼ -0.2 pp
2008 100.0% ₩1.17 Trillion ₩0.00 ₩2.81 Trillion ▲ +0.1 pp
2007 99.9% ₩923.36 Billion ₩825.39 Million ₩2.12 Trillion ▼ -0.1 pp
2006 100.0% ₩528.64 Billion ₩778.00K ₩1.41 Trillion ▲ +0.7 pp
2005 99.3% ₩396.95 Billion ₩2.71 Billion ₩1.23 Trillion ▲ +0.9 pp
2004 98.4% ₩338.03 Billion ₩5.41 Billion ₩1.23 Trillion ▼ -1.6 pp
2003 100.0% ₩122.54 Billion ₩1.95 Million ₩1.12 Trillion ▲ +0.0 pp
2002 100.0% ₩86.45 Billion ₩2.60 Million ₩1.21 Trillion ▲ +0.0 pp
2001 100.0% ₩19.78 Billion ₩3.26 Million ₩1.22 Trillion ▼ 0.0 pp
2000 100.0% ₩55.50 Billion ₩3.92 Million ₩1.24 Trillion
pp = percentage points
